Overview

This textbook provides a comprehensive modeling, reformulation and optimization approach for solving production planning and supply chain planning problems, covering topics from a basic introduction to planning systems, mixed integer programming (MIP) models and algorithms through the advanced description of mathematical results in polyhedral combinatorics required to solve these problems. Based on twenty years worth of research in which the authors have played a significant role, the book addresses real life industrial production planning problems (involving complex production structures with multiple production stages) using MIP modeling and reformulation approach. The book provides an introduction to MIP modeling and to planning systems, a unique collection of reformulation results, and an easy to use problem-solving library. This approach is demonstrated through a series of real life case studies, exercises and detailed illustrations. Review by Jakub Marecek (Computer Journal) The emphasis put on mixed integer rounding and mixing sets, heuristics in-built in general purpose integer programming solvers, as well as on decompositions and heuristics using integer programming should be praised...There is no doubt that this volume offers the present best introduction to integer programming formulations of lotsizing problems, encountered in production planning. (2007)

Table of Contents

Production Planning and MIP.- The Modeling and Optimization Approach.- Production Planning Models and Systems.- Mixed Integer Programming Algorithms.- Classification and Reformulation.- Reformulations in Practice.- Basic Polyhedral Combinatorics for Production Planning and MIP.- Mixed Integer Programming Algorithms and Decomposition Approaches.- Single-Item Uncapacitated Lot-Sizing.- Basic MIP and Fixed Cost Flow Models.- Single-Item Lot-Sizing.- Lot-Sizing with Capacities.- Backlogging and Start-Ups.- Single-Item Variants.- Multi-Item Lot-Sizing.- Multi-Item Single-Level Problems.- Multi-Level Lot-Sizing Problems.- Problem Solving.- Test Problems.
